当前位置 主页 > 技术大全 >

    动易CMS脚本开发全攻略
    动易cms脚本之家

    栏目:技术大全 时间:2025-08-28 04:54

    系统架构深度解析

    动易CMS作为国内知名的内容管理系统,其脚本开发环境为开发者提供了强大的扩展能力。系统采用ASP.NET技术架构,支持C#和VB.NET两种开发语言,为脚本编写提供了灵活的选择空间。

    核心脚本模块包含模板标签系统、插件接口机制以及数据库操作组件,开发者可以通过这些模块快速实现功能定制。特别值得一提的是其独特的标签解析引擎,允许开发者通过简单的标签调用实现复杂的数据展示逻辑。

    脚本开发最佳实践

    在实际开发过程中,建议采用模块化编程思想。首先熟悉系统提供的API接口文档,了解常用对象如Page类、DBHelper类的使用方法。其次,充分利用系统的事件机制,通过注册相应事件实现业务逻辑的注入。

    安全性是脚本开发的重中之重。所有用户输入都必须经过严格验证,SQL查询务必使用参数化方式,防止注入攻击。同时要注意对文件上传功能的权限控制和类型检查。

    调试与优化技巧

    动易CMS提供了详细的日志记录功能,开发过程中可通过查看系统日志快速定位问题。对于性能要求较高的场景,建议使用缓存机制减少数据库查询次数,同时注意及时释放资源,避免内存泄漏。

    通过掌握这些脚本开发技巧,开发者能够充分发挥动易CMS的强大功能,打造出高性能、安全稳定的网站应用。

1分钟搞定MySQL部署!Docker最强实操指南,含所有常用命令和配置
忘记MySQL密码怎么办?别慌!用这一招跳过验证,轻松重置管理员权限
MySQL自增主键用完怎么办?从原理到实战,全面破解开发中的高频难题
MySQL权限混乱?这几个命令让你彻底理清用户清单与权限归属
你的数据库安全吗?读懂MySQL这几种日志,关键时刻能「救你一命」
MySQL性能上不去?八成是这里没配好!手把手教你搞定my.cnf核心配置
修改MySQL字段长度别乱来!这3个核心要点和1个致命陷阱,新手必看
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
你的MySQL数据库为什么总是又慢又卡?掌握这五大优化法则,查询速度快十倍!(上篇)
你的MySQL数据库为什么总是又慢又卡?掌握这五大优化法则,查询速度快十倍!(下篇)